*George of the Jungle 2* (2003).
A cheap, terrible sequel in every respect. The CGI is atrocious, only a couple of actors return, every plot beat is utterly clichéd, and instead of having fun with kids like the first movie did, this one sardonically talks down to them. The only positive is that it's mercifully short.
My rating: 15%.
*Hocus Pocus 2* (2022).
I didn't like the first movie either, but this sequel disappoints for different reasons; it's more underwhelming than annoying. There are several unwelcome retcons, it tries to have its cake and eat it regarding the villains being simply misunderstood, and how do the witches suddenly know *One Way or Another*?
My rating: 35%.
*Maleficent: Mistress of Evil* (2019).
It's only slightly better than the first movie. It's at least easier to appreciate as its own thing, but every plot beat is so bog-standard that the supposedly emotional moments fall completely flat. When Maleficent's exploring the Dark Fey cavern, it somehow looks like a scene straight out of *Avatar*.
My rating: 45%.
